Title: Innovations by Robin Beat Gasser: A Focus on Anthelmintic Compounds

Introduction

Robin Beat Gasser is a prominent inventor based in Werribee, Australia, known for his contributions to the field of organic chemistry and pharmacology. With a total of three patents to his name, he has made significant strides in developing innovative compounds that target parasitic diseases.

Latest Patents

Gasser’s latest patents focus on organometallic compounds with therapeutic applications. His recent inventions include:

1. **Organometallic 2-cyano-2-aminobenzoate-propyl derivatives** - This invention relates to specific compounds designed for use as anthelmintics, targeting parasitic infections effectively.

2. **Bis-organometallic 2-amino-3-hydroxy-2-methylpropanenitrile derivatives** - This patent details compounds that also serve as anthelmintics, characterized by unique chemical structures that include metal compounds.

These advancements in anthelmintic agents highlight the potent potential of Gasser’s work in combating parasitic diseases through innovative chemical solutions.
